(Redirected from Galway-Cavendish-Harvey, Ontario)'Galway-Cavendish and Harvey' is a
township in the rural, mostly wooded northern section of
Peterborough County,
Ontario,
Canada.
The municipality was formed in
1998 through an amalgamation of the Township of Galway & Cavendish and the Township of Harvey.
Galway-Cavendish-Harvey is home to
Kawartha Highlands Provincial Park, which is set around Catchacoma Lake and Mississauga Lake, where the old Harvey fire tower once stood. Two hurricanes have hit this area- one in 1927 and the other in the 1990's. The area is also a popular
cottaging and recreational area.
Demographics
According to the
2006 Statistics Canada Census:
★ Population: 5,284
★ % Change (
2001-
2006): 20.9
★ Dwellings: 5,407
★ Area (km².): 848.26
★ Density (persons per km².): 6.2
